Shiplap siding replacement is a crucial home improvement task that ensures the longevity and aesthetic appeal of your property. Over time, shiplap siding can suffer from wear and tear due to exposure to the elements, leading to potential damage such as warping, rotting, or cracking. By replacing old or damaged shiplap siding, homeowners can maintain the structural integrity of their homes and enhance curb appeal. This process not only protects the house from moisture and pests but also provides an opportunity to update the home's exterior with fresh, modern materials that can improve energy efficiency and boost property value. Investing in shiplap siding replacement is an essential step in maintaining a safe, attractive, and comfortable living environment.
Benefits of Shiplap Siding Replacement
-
Enhanced Curb Appeal
Replacing old shiplap siding with new materials can significantly enhance the aesthetic appeal of your home. Fresh siding gives your property a clean and updated look, which can be particularly beneficial if you are considering selling your home. A modern exterior can attract potential buyers and increase the perceived value of your property. -
Improved Durability
New shiplap siding is designed to withstand harsh weather conditions better than older materials. By replacing your siding, you ensure that your home is protected against rain, wind, and other environmental factors that can cause damage over time. This improvement in durability means less maintenance and repair work in the future. -
Increased Energy Efficiency
Modern shiplap siding materials offer improved insulation properties, which can contribute to better energy efficiency in your home. By replacing outdated siding, you can reduce heat loss during the winter and keep your home cooler in the summer, potentially lowering your energy bills and enhancing indoor comfort.
